“Potato Head for JOURNAL STANDARD” Releases Special Collection Fusing Tradition and Modernity
JOURNAL STANDARD will release a special collection, "Potato Head for JOURNAL STANDARD –Seeds of Life-", in collaboration with the Indonesian lifestyle brand Potato Head in mid-May. The collection features sustainable resort casual wear using traditional Balinese hand-weaving technique "IKAT" and natural dyes.

continues to disseminate a unique lifestyle rooted in Indonesian craftsmanship and sustainability, centered around art, music, food, and wellness.
They deliver the traditional handicraft techniques and aesthetics deeply rooted in Bali beyond local boundaries to the world, through the core concept of "fusing tradition and modernity."
This season's apparel collection is dyed with natural dyes made from plants native to various islands such as Bali, Java, and Sumatra, and features Balinese "Aksara" script and Javanese "Parang" patterns in various places.
In response, a JOURNAL STANDARD exclusive bespoke collection will be launched.
"IKAT" is a Balinese hand-weaving technique that creates patterns by dyeing threads before weaving.
This fabric, which embodies the unique undulations of handcraft within its regularity, has been re-engineered into a piece with a modern fitting.
To the apparel, which embodies the lightness of natural materials and the rustic charm derived from handcrafted work, leather Gurkha sandals and classical jackets add elegance. The neatness stands out in a style with ample room.
